Fe 2 O 3 Variants Uncoated Fe 2 O 3 NPs (US3160) showed a trend to decrease MN induction at all concentrations tested (potential interference) and induced a significant decrease relative to negative control only at 20 μg/mL, whereas Fe 2 O 3 MPs induced a 1.8-MN-fold increase at the highest concentration of 40 μg/mL ( Figure 8 H).

With regards to % relative survival, although a decreasing trend was observed at the highest concentration of 20 μg/mL of the uncoated or coated ZnO NPs or 33 μg/mL of ZnCl 2 , none of them induced a statistically significant decrease compared to the matched negative control at 2 or 4 h ( Figure S13A ), the exposure durations used for the comet assay.
